If you’re craving a taste of the Mediterranean, Greek Chicken Meatballs with Lemon Orzo is the perfect dish to bring warmth and flavor to your table. These delightful meatballs made from lean ground chicken are infused with fresh herbs and zesty lemon, creating a harmonious blend of tastes that everyone will love. Whether it’s a busy weeknight or a gathering with family and friends, this recipe is quick to prepare and sure to impress. Plus, it’s packed with wholesome ingredients, making it a nourishing choice for any meal.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b ground chicken
  • 1/4 cup breadcrumbs
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on fresh oregano, chopped
  • 1 cup orzo pasta
  • Juice of 1 lemon
  • Zest of 1 lemon
  • 2 cups vegetable broth or water
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ine ground chicken, breadcrumbs, garlic, parsley, oregano, salt, and pepper. Mix until well combined.
  2. Shape the mixture into golf ball-sized meatballs and place them on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
  3.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and bake meatballs for about 20 minutes or until golden brown.
  4. Meanwhile, boil vegetable broth in a separate pot. Add orzo and cook according to package instructions until al dente.
  5. Once cooked, drain excess liquid and stir in lemon juice, zest, salt, and pepper.
  6. Serve orzo topped with meatballs and garnish with additional parsley if desired.
